Motocross Madness 2 (MCM2) remains a cult favorite for its massive open-world stunts and physics-based racing. However, running this 2000 classic on modern systems like Windows 10 or 11 is challenging because it uses , which is no longer supported by Microsoft due to security vulnerabilities .
A no CD patch is a software modification that allows a game to run without the original CD. It works by modifying the game's executable file or by creating a virtual CD drive that tricks the game into thinking the CD is present. No CD patches are usually created by gamers or third-party developers who want to make games more accessible.
